本文目录导读:
随着信息技术的飞速发展,企业对数据管理的要求越来越高,数据仓库和MPP数据库作为企业数据管理的重要工具,它们在功能、架构、应用场景等方面有着紧密的联系,本文将深入探讨数据仓库与MPP数据库的关系,旨在为企业提供更高效、便捷的数据管理解决方案。
数据仓库与MPP数据库的定义
1、数据仓库
数据仓库(Data Warehouse)是一种面向主题、集成的、非易失性的、支持数据分析和决策的数据集合,它将企业内部和外部数据源进行整合,以支持企业业务决策,数据仓库具有以下特点:
图片来源于网络,如有侵权联系删除
(1)面向主题:数据仓库按照业务主题进行组织,便于用户快速找到所需数据。
(2)集成性:数据仓库将来自不同数据源的数据进行整合,消除数据孤岛。
(3)非易失性:数据仓库中的数据不会因业务操作而改变。
(4)支持数据分析和决策:数据仓库提供强大的数据查询和分析功能,支持企业决策。
2、MPP数据库
MPP数据库(Massively Parallel Processing Database)是一种采用并行处理技术的数据库系统,它将数据存储在多个节点上,通过并行计算提高查询效率,MPP数据库具有以下特点:
(1)并行处理:MPP数据库将数据分散存储在多个节点上,通过并行计算提高查询效率。
(2)高并发:MPP数据库支持高并发访问,满足大规模数据处理需求。
(3)易于扩展:MPP数据库可根据需求进行横向扩展,提高系统性能。
图片来源于网络,如有侵权联系删除
数据仓库与MPP数据库的关系
1、数据仓库是MPP数据库的数据来源
数据仓库作为企业数据管理的重要工具,其核心功能是将来自各个业务系统的数据进行整合,MPP数据库作为数据仓库的后端存储,为数据仓库提供高效、稳定的数据存储和查询支持,在数据仓库与MPP数据库的协同工作中,数据仓库负责数据整合、处理和分析,而MPP数据库负责数据存储和查询。
2、MPP数据库优化数据仓库查询性能
由于MPP数据库采用并行处理技术,其在查询性能方面具有明显优势,当数据仓库进行复杂查询时,MPP数据库能够通过并行计算提高查询效率,从而提升数据仓库的整体性能。
3、MPP数据库与数据仓库共同构建大数据平台
随着大数据时代的到来,企业对数据管理的要求越来越高,数据仓库与MPP数据库的协同工作,为企业构建大数据平台提供了有力支持,通过整合企业内部和外部数据,数据仓库和MPP数据库共同助力企业实现数据驱动决策。
数据仓库与MPP数据库的应用场景
1、企业数据仓库
数据仓库是企业进行数据分析和决策的重要工具,MPP数据库作为数据仓库的后端存储,能够满足企业对海量数据的高效查询需求,在企业数据仓库中,MPP数据库可应用于以下场景:
(1)数据整合:将来自不同业务系统的数据进行整合,消除数据孤岛。
图片来源于网络,如有侵权联系删除
(2)数据挖掘:通过数据仓库和MPP数据库的协同工作,挖掘数据价值。
(3)业务分析:为企业提供全面、实时的业务数据,支持决策。
2、大数据平台
在大数据平台中,数据仓库和MPP数据库共同构建高效、稳定的数据处理体系,以下为MPP数据库在大数据平台中的应用场景:
(1)数据采集:通过MPP数据库的并行处理能力,实现海量数据的实时采集。
(2)数据存储:MPP数据库提供高效、稳定的数据存储能力,满足大数据平台需求。
(3)数据挖掘:利用数据仓库和MPP数据库的协同工作,挖掘数据价值。
数据仓库与MPP数据库在功能、架构、应用场景等方面具有紧密的联系,它们共同为企业提供高效、便捷的数据管理解决方案,助力企业在数据驱动时代取得成功,在未来的发展中,数据仓库与MPP数据库将继续协同共进,构筑高效数据管理新格局。
标签: #数据仓库和mpp数据库的关系是什么
评论列表